The significance of this equimolar relationship cannot be overstated.C-Peptide - an overview Because C-peptide is released alongside insulin, it serves as an excellent biomarker for insulin production. Unlike insulin itself, which can be exogenously administered (e.g., through insulin injections for diabetes management), C-peptide levels in the blood directly reflect the body's own endogenous insulin secretion. This makes C-peptide a reliable indicator of how well your pancreas makes insulin.

For instance, a low level (or no C-peptide) indicates that the pancreas is producing little or no insulin, often a hallmark of Type 1 diabetes. Conversely, in Type 2 diabetes, while insulin resistance may be present, the pancreas might still be producing insulin, leading to detectable C-peptide levels.

This understanding is critical for diagnosing and managing various endocrine conditions. For example, C-peptide is used as a test of beta-cell function in a variety of conditions, including aiding in the differential diagnosis of hypoglycemia (low blood sugar) and evaluating for conditions like insulinoma, a tumor that causes excessive insulin production.
Furthermore, the C-peptide molecule itself is a chain of amino acids (the building blocks of proteins), specifically a 31 amino acid residue segment that links insulin chain A to chain B in proinsulin. This structural detail is crucial for the correct folding and assembly of the insulin molecule during its synthesis.
